Artist Bio

The smoothly-tuned Canadian crooner undoubtedly resides among the most critically noted R&B artists of the past decade. The anachronistic musician took cues from his background in gospel music to develop a sonic texture comparable to the distinct voices of the Frank Oceans and Sam Cookes of music history. His father’s work as a pastor and gospel singer imbued music with deep meaning for Caesar from an early age. After singing for his father’s congregation during his childhood, Caesar swiftly took to music as a personal passion. Yet as his musical interest developed, it delved into more secular themes. This created a divide between him and his parents, which in part led to him being kicked out of his home at age 17. Newly independent, he took the risk of clinging even closer to his dream.

His 2014 debut EP, Praise Break, had limited recognition but was enough to land him a spot at Golden Child Records. It also laid the ideal groundwork for his future endeavors, including his far more successful 2015 EP, Pilgrim’s Paradise. The thoroughly stripped-down seven-song project reinvigorated Caesar’s sound and expanded his reach to more mainstream audiences. Since that pivotal milestone in his career, Caesar’s music took little time to reach extreme heights, with the 2017 release of his critically acclaimed and certified gold LP, Freudian. Since the release of what has thus far been his career touchstone, Caesar has propelled his career forward through collaborations with John Mayer, Sean Leon, Pharell, and Brandy on his most recent album, CASE STUDY 01.
